If you like design and the great signatures of the last century, this is the opportunity! The Carpenters Gallery brings together 90 pieces (a record) by Zanine Caldas, figurehead of Brazilian modernism. A creator as gifted as he is a pioneer in his way of considering the reuse of wood waste, factory scraps and even dead trees, and of committing to the local know-how of communities. On three floors of 54 rue de la Verrerie and in the adjacent private apartment, the exhibition gives free rein to apprehend this gigantic work, first centered on industrial rationality before moving, from the 1970s, to the 'arts and crafts. In 1989, the Museum of Decorative Arts in Paris organized "Zanin: the architect of the forest". It's time to find it! upcarpentersworkshopgallery.com
